Description




From the Research, I extracted some features can be applied into my product.

Also I defined the identity of my product, and find innovative ways.

+ I named this project e-toy crew; is an ambient device, which reacts to messages,

updates and many other situations in social networks
Since it is collectable, users can choose different toy according to their favor or purpose

(E toy crew consists of Face book toy,Twitter toy, Google toy,U-tube toy and Skype toy)

E- toys are getting developed through being feeded treated owned (emotional)/ talking

playing loving ( Functional) / being Selled, created, boomed up (Business)

Research -bearbrick - movement


Be@rbrick is a collectible toy designed and produced
by the Japanese company MediCom Toy Incorporated.

The name is derived from the fact that the figure is
a cartoon-style representation of a bear, and that it
is a variation of MediCom's Kubrick design.
The at sign in the place of the letter a is a visual
device that is a part of the Be@rbrick brand, and
as such, a trademark of MediCom Toy.
